#f430bc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f430bc is composed of 95.7% red, 18.8%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.3% magenta, 23%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 317.1 degrees, a saturation of 89.9% and a lightness of 57.3%. #f430bc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ff60ff with #e90079.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#f430bc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f430bc has RGB values of R:244, G:48,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.23,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16003260.

Shades and Tints of #f430bc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#11010c is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#f430bc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#988c94 is the less saturated color, while #fc28c0 is the most saturated one.
